Mazda has recently announced 400
Limited edition supply of RX-8 . These will be equipped with bespoke 18”
aluminum wheels and Alcantara seat trim. It will also be fitted with a
aerodynamic rear spoiler. Body color choice is either Crystal White Pearlescent
or Grey Mica. The leather Alcantara red & black combi seats and luxury room
carpets will also be available to choose from.

Mazda RX-8 Design
One of the signature design cues
of the RX-8 which makes it so famous among enthusiasts is the rear-hinged
“freestyle” doors. This “freestyle” layout gives the RX-8 a “suicide” door
appeal and, functionally makes the rear seats a lot easier to get in to.
Power of Rotary
Rotary engine was first invented
in 1957 by a German Engineer named Felix Wankel. He believed in 4 strokes as to
be achieved while rotating. Initially there was no success in the automobiles
and it disappeared from the vehicle manufacturers engineering labs until Mr.
Masuda Tsuneji identified the potential and worked with NSU in the research and
development of rotary engine.
The RX-8 is also a powerful car.
It uses a naturally aspirated, 1.3L Renesis rotary engine which can develop a
maximum of 246 hp at 8,500 rpm with the sustained redline pegged at 8,500 rpm
and a peak redline at 9,000 rpm. The engine performed well enough to win the
International Engine of the Year and Best New Engine awards in 2003.
